Partager via


Extensions.Forward<R> Méthode

Définition

Appelez un dialogue enfant, ajoutez-le en haut de la pile et publiez le message dans le dialogue enfant.

public static System.Threading.Tasks.Task Forward<R> (this Microsoft.Bot.Builder.Dialogs.Internals.IDialogStack stack, Microsoft.Bot.Builder.Dialogs.IDialog<R> child, Microsoft.Bot.Builder.Dialogs.ResumeAfter<R> resume, Microsoft.Bot.Connector.IMessageActivity message, System.Threading.CancellationToken token = default);
static member Forward : Microsoft.Bot.Builder.Dialogs.Internals.IDialogStack * Microsoft.Bot.Builder.Dialogs.IDialog<'R> * Microsoft.Bot.Builder.Dialogs.ResumeAfter<'R> * Microsoft.Bot.Connector.IMessageActivity * System.Threading.CancellationToken -> System.Threading.Tasks.Task
<Extension()>
Public Function Forward(Of R) (stack As IDialogStack, child As IDialog(Of R), resume As ResumeAfter(Of R), message As IMessageActivity, Optional token As CancellationToken = Nothing) As Task

Paramètres de type

R

Type de résultat attendu du dialogue enfant.

Paramètres

stack
IDialogStack

Pile de dialogues.

child
IDialog<R>

Boîte de dialogue enfant.

resume
ResumeAfter<R>

Méthode à reprendre une fois la boîte de dialogue enfant terminée.

message
IMessageActivity

Message qui sera publié dans la boîte de dialogue enfant.

token
CancellationToken

Jeton d'annulation.

Retours

Tâche représentant l’opération Forward.

S’applique à